Shipping Glossary
COMMON SHIPPING TERMS
Rate | |
The price of a transport service | |
Quantity, amount or degree measured or applied | |
Rebate | |
That part of a transport charge which the carrier agrees to return. | |
Receipt | |
A written acknowledgement, that something has been received. | |
Reefer Cargo | |
Cargo requiring temperature control. | |
Reefer Container | |
A thermal container with refrigerating appliances (mechanical compressor unit, absorption unit etc.) to control the temperature of cargo. | |
Regroupage | |
The process of splitting up shipments into various consignments (degroupage) and combining these small consignments into other shipments (groupage). | |
Release Order | |
A document issued by or on behalf of the carrier authorising the release of import cargo identified thereon and manifested under a single Bill of Lading. Go to top Roll-on Roll-off Abbreviation: RoRo System of loading and discharging a vessel whereby the cargo is driven on and off by means of a ramp. |
|
Route | |
The track along which goods are (to be) transported. | |
Routing | |
The determination of the most efficient route(s) that people, goods, materials and or means of transport have to follow | |
The process of determining how a shipment will be moved between consignor and consignee or between place of acceptance by the carrier and place of delivery to the consignee | |
The process of aiding a vessel's navigation by supplying long range weather forecasts and indicating the most economic and save sailing route. | |
